Jurnal Lentera Insani (JLI) is an international, double-blind, peer-reviewed, open-access journal dedicated to substantive dialogue between the social sciences and Islamic studies across Asia. The journal combines rigorous empirical investigations with innovative theoretical interventions, adopting interdisciplinary, multidisciplinary, and transdisciplinary perspectives to illuminate how Islamic thought and practice respond to rapidly shifting social, technological, and environmental landscapes. The journal cultivates both depth and breadth of analysis, enabling nuanced exploration of the challenges and opportunities confronting Muslim communities across the region.
